Auto merge of #75677 - cuviper:shrink-towel, r=Mark-Simulacrum
Don't panic in Vec::shrink_to_fit

We can help the compiler see that `Vec::shrink_to_fit` will never reach the panic case in `RawVec::shrink_to_fit`, just by guarding the call only for cases where the capacity is strictly greater. A capacity less than the length is only possible through an unsafe call to `set_len`, which would break the `Vec` invariants, so `shrink_to_fit` can just ignore that.

This removes the panicking code from the examples in both #71861 and #75636.

diff --git a/src/test/codegen/vec-shrink-panic.rs b/src/test/codegen/vec-shrink-panic.rs
new file mode 100644
index 00000000000..690c7e6d6ce
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/test/codegen/vec-shrink-panic.rs
@@ -0,0 +1,36 @@
+// compile-flags: -O
+// ignore-debug: the debug assertions get in the way
+#![crate_type = "lib"]
+#![feature(shrink_to)]
+
+// Make sure that `Vec::shrink_to_fit` never emits panics via `RawVec::shrink_to_fit`,
+// "Tried to shrink to a larger capacity", because the length is *always* <= capacity.
+
+// CHECK-LABEL: @shrink_to_fit
+#[no_mangle]
+pub fn shrink_to_fit(vec: &mut Vec<u32>) {
+    // CHECK-NOT: panic
+    vec.shrink_to_fit();
+}
+
+// CHECK-LABEL: @issue71861
+#[no_mangle]
+pub fn issue71861(n: usize) -> Box<[u32]> {
+    // CHECK-NOT: panic
+    vec![0; n].into_boxed_slice()
+}
+
+// CHECK-LABEL: @issue75636
+#[no_mangle]
+pub fn issue75636<'a>(iter: &[&'a str]) -> Box<[&'a str]> {
+    // CHECK-NOT: panic
+    iter.iter().copied().collect()
+}
+
+// Sanity-check that we do see a possible panic for an arbitrary `Vec::shrink_to`.
+// CHECK-LABEL: @shrink_to
+#[no_mangle]
+pub fn shrink_to(vec: &mut Vec<u32>) {
+    // CHECK: panic
+    vec.shrink_to(42);
+}
